Did Monday's training as expected. Getting closer to the basic standards for ATG which means I can then move onto one of the more specialised programs. Looking forward to that.
Food and BW has been weird. I think I'm done with IF for a while. Feel like I never have a chance to put on any muscle even when I eat perfectly. Just started doing the 4-6 meals a day thing. So far so good. Body feels good. BW is higher but I'm also looking leaner. Haven't been tracking waist measurements though so that's the first step. Will go back to that and periodically check the bw. One thing I'm realising is that being "skinny fat" or just plain old skinny doesn't really fit the same rules as everything else. Was reading an interesting post the other day about body fat scanners and how most people will get a range of 1-2% difference between Dexa and bodypod etc. Skinny/skinny fat dudes like myself will get variances of up to 10% which is what I have experienced. I legit thing my bodyfat is low teens if not lower so think it's finally time to add some muscle to fill out this frame.
